01

Observed

What the monitor directly saw, heard, measured or confirmed in the field.

The work area was inactive at 10:14 AM.
02

Reported

Information tied to the person or source who provided it.

The supervisor reported that work stopped earlier.
03

Documented

A statement supported by an available project record.

The project record shows a revised sequence.
04

Unclear

A point that has not yet been verified and must not become a guess.

The exact stop time remains unverified.
